Abstract

Modeling soil-structure interaction subjected to harmonic load is important, particularly the harmonic problem at boundary domain. Calculation at the boundary is complicated due to the wave forwarded to the infinity and reflections that come back. Some research is conducted to develop a model that utilizes Integral transform to get response from the structure and its interaction with soil layer subjected to harmonic load. Methodology: A mathematical model is developed on the interaction between half space layer and the structure on it, with soil layer below (half space). The analysis utilizes a partial differential coupled Lame equation. Simulation results show that the developed model can calculate response from the structure and soil layer subjected to harmonic load by ITM – FEM coupling. Results carried out on layered soil show that the maximum amplitude resultant displacements Uz, depends highly on various loads that work in the half space layer, comparison of soil elastic modulus values El/E2, comparison of soil damping values ξ1/ ξ2, and also comparison of soil density value of each soil layer ρ1/ ρ2. The impact of El/E2 value on the maximum amplitude resultant displacements Uz is higher compared to the impact of ξ1/ ξ2 damping values or ρ1/ ρ2 soil density values.
